    The Philadelphia Inquirer ^ | 7/2/2022 | by Rita Giordano
    Mina’s World, the West Philadelphia coffee shop that drew local and national attention as a community-oriented and LGBTQ inclusive space, has closed. “We don’t have enough money to continue operating,” read the message posted Friday on Mina’s Instagram. “The People’s Fridge will stay in place for this moment — if we are asked to move it we find another host in West Philly. “Thank you for the opportunity to serve you in the ways we were able to.” *SNIP* In recent weeks, evidently a dispute had arisen between some of Mina’s employees and the cafe’s owners.
